What did the grandmother give to Kezia when she was sobbing?

In the story “The Little Girl” (Class 9 English, Beehive), when Kezia was sobbing after being hit by her father, her grandmother comforted her gently and gave her a **clean handkerchief** to wipe her tears and blow her nose.

“Here’s a clean hanky, darling. Blow your nose. Go to sleep, pet; you’ll forget all about it in the morning.”

This small act shows the grandmother’s tenderness and emotional support for Kezia at a time when she felt scared and hurt.

Why this detail matters in the story

The clean handkerchief is a simple object, but it represents:
  • Care and affection : The grandmother is the only consistently soft, understanding figure in Kezia’s life.
  • Emotional safety : When Kezia is frightened of her father, she turns to her grandmother, who comforts her with physical warmth (rocking chair, shawl) and gentle words, along with the handkerchief.

This moment helps highlight the emotional contrast between Kezia’s strict father and her loving grandmother.
